Role Description INSPYR Solutions is seeking a Workday HRIS Digital Experience Analyst to support a leading enterprise client. This individual will be responsible for creating, maintaining, governing, and optimizing the digital HR experience within Workday. Serving as the primary owner of Workday Help Knowledge Management, the analyst will ensure employees, managers, and HR teams have access to accurate, timely, and user-friendly self-service content. The ideal candidate has experience configuring Workday HCM and Workday Help, enjoys improving digital employee experiences, and thrives in a collaborative HR technology environment. - Create, publish, maintain, and retire Workday Help knowledge articles. - Establish content standards, governance processes, and review cycles to ensure information remains accurate and compliant. - Partner with HR functional teams to identify, document, and continuously improve knowledge content. - Own content categorization, tagging, search optimization, and audience targeting. - Ensure knowledge articles align with HR policies, procedures, and business processes. - Identify opportunities to simplify HR processes through knowledge management, automation, guidance, and self-service capabilities. - Collaborate with HRIS, HR Shared Services, HR Centers of Excellence, Communications, Change Management, and Technology teams. - Promote employee self-service adoption and improve the overall digital HR experience. - Coordinate translation and localization efforts for global knowledge content when applicable. - Monitor user behavior, search trends, and knowledge effectiveness to continuously improve content. Qualifications - Associate's degree in a related field, or an additional two (2) years of relevant experience in lieu of a degree. - Experience configuring Workday HCM and Workday Help. - 3+ years of experience in HR Operations, HR Technology, Knowledge Management, Digital Experience, Communications, or a related field. - Experience developing and managing content within enterprise systems. - Strong Microsoft Office skills, including Outlook,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. -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ills. - Self-motivated with excellent organizational and project management abilities. -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ment. Requirements - 1+ year supporting global HR organizations. - Experience supporting HR Shared Services or employee service delivery operations. - Knowledge of employee self-service, case management, and knowledge management best practices. - Experience with AI-powered support tools, chatbots, or digital assistants. - Experience supporting multilingual/global content environments. Role Description The Senior Client Support Analyst is the highest-level individual contributor within the pod and serves as the in-team escalation point for Analysts I through III. The Senior carries a ticket load — specifically the most complex tickets in the pod’s queue — but must reserve capacity to accept escalations from the working group when issues exceed their capability. When an escalation arrives, the Senior prioritizes it over personal queue work. This is the ceiling of the Client Support IC ladder. From here, career progression moves in one of three directions: - Into the centralized Escalation Support team for those who want to pursue the deepest technical challenges. - Into a Supervisor or management track for those drawn to leadership. - Into Infrastructure or Security Operations for those seeking specialization. The Senior is also the quality gate for escalations leaving the pod. When an issue has genuinely exceeded the pod’s collective capability, the Senior makes the determination to engage the Escalation Support team and ensures every escalation that leaves the pod is complete, contextual, and actionable. The Senior’s impact is measured not only by the tickets they resolve but by the capability they build in the people around them. Operational Mission: Handle the hardest work in the pod. Raise the floor around you so the team needs you less, not more. Key Responsibilities - CULTURE & VALUES: Uphold LayerCake’s core values in every interaction with clients and teammates. - TICKET RESOLUTION & IN-TEAM ESCALATION: - Carry a ticket load of the most complex tickets in the pod’s queue while maintaining availability to accept in-team escalations from Analysts I through III. - Accept and resolve escalated issues from the working group (Analysts I–III) that exceed their capability. When an escalation arrives, prioritize it over personal queue work. - Resolve the most complex non-Escalation-Support issues in the pod, including advanced server administration, complex networking issues, cloud platform troubleshooting, multi-system diagnostic work, and security incident triage. - Perform thorough root cause analysis on complex and recurring issues. Document findings and drive toward permanent resolution, not repeated band-aids. - Maintain deep familiarity with client environments across the pod’s portfolio, including infrastructure configurations, known issues, change history, and client-specific nuances. - Support complex user onboarding scenarios that exceed Analysts I-III capability, particularly for users with non-standard access requirements, executive-level configurations, or complex multi-system provisioning. - Make the judgment call on when an issue should escalate to the Escalation Support team. Ensure every escalation that leaves the pod is complete, contextual, and actionable. - MENTORSHIP & CAPABILITY BUILDING: - Actively mentor Analysts at all levels within the pod. This is not optional — it is a core function of the role. - Conduct ticket reviews, provide real-time coaching during complex troubleshooting, and lead knowledge-sharing sessions within the team. - Author and maintain advanced technical documentation in the knowledge base, including complex resolution paths, environmental configurations, and diagnostic procedures. - Identify skill gaps within the pod and work with the Supervisor or CSM to develop targeted training or cross-training plans. - CLIENT COMMUNICATION: - Serve as a trusted technical contact for clients on the most complex issues. Confidence, clarity, and follow-through are essential. - Participate in client operational reviews or meetings as directed by the CSM. - OPERATIONAL DISCIPLINE: - Maintain accurate time entries on every ticket. - Follow ticket handling standards and serve as the documentation quality standard-bearer for the pod. - Identify operational inefficiencies, recurring issue patterns, and process improvement opportunities. Bring data-supported recommendations to the Supervisor or CSM. - Participate in the on-call rotation as scheduled, serving as an escalation resource for the After-Hours support team and on-call Analysts I-III during assigned on-call windows.
